Experience the rare, tropical taste of raw Kiawe Honey from Hawaiʻi — a highly sought after white honey harvested from the blossoms of Kiawe trees in the Hawaiian Islands. Bottled while still liquid, this raw, unfiltered honey naturally crystallizes right away in the jar, creating a thick, granular texture. With its delicate tropical flavor, bold sweetness, and subtle floral notes, Kiawe Honey is truly one of nature’s treasures. Packed with natural enzymes and antioxidants, it’s perfect for pairing with fresh fruit, spreading on toast, blending into coffee or tea, or simply savoring by the spoonful. Sustainably harvested, our premium Hawaiian Kiawe Honey delivers pure island flavor in every jar.

Flavor profile: delicate tropical sweetness with subtle floral notes. Naturally thick, scoopable crystalline texture.

Pairs well with: charcuterie & cheese assortments, fruits, toast, desserts, coffee & tea, or simply by the spoonful

Natural raw honey does not expire when properly preserved (airtight container, preferably glass, kept away from heat and light helps to maintain its quality and longevity) The combination of low water activity, high sugar content, acidity, and antibacterial properties makes honey a naturally long-lasting food. You may, however, see changes in the color and texture over time since it’s a natural product. 
Raw Honey may be stored in either the pantry or refrigerator. It does not need to be refrigerated, but we recommend refrigerating if the honey will be stored more than a few months before it is completely consumed.
